Siti hyunteo (2011)
Action-packed excitement!
Although this show might have started off slow and boring for me by the end I was gripping on to my seat in nerve-wracking anticipation. The action was authentic and the characters completely lovable. I would like to have seen more romance between the lead couple but their chemistry either way was evident. The plot had a few loose ends and I hated the ending which left me feeling unfulfilled, but I'll forgive the makers on the grounds that I loved the series as a whole. I would definitely recommend watching this to anyone who loves the good looking hero with a hidden identity trying to save the world and protect his lady love, etc etc.
Mirror Mirror (2012)
Weird, wacky, warped
Firstly, I'm a big fan of the classic fairy tales and though the Disney's PG13 versions are entertaining, frankly I'd like to see something with a bit more grit in it. The original Snow White certainly wasn't a sweet, enchanting love story. Well this one was.
The evil Queen wasn't evil enough for me. There was no huntsman. And the Prince appeared all to soon (with a mighty sense of humour and a slight lack of nobleness or decorum - not that I was complaining the guy was shirtless half the time).
If you're looking for a fun, comedy-ish, sort of movie I'd recommend this to you. Not if you want something that's a true adaptation or even slightly close.
The Three Musketeers (2011)
Limited
The Three Musketeers has been made and remade at least a dozen times in history after Alexander Dumas's writing came out. We keep expecting the next one to be better than the last and perhaps it's that expectation that lets us down sometimes.
The movie has some wonderful effects and visuals thanks to modern technology and advancements in cinema but that's all I enjoyed. The actors were fantastic people but used poorly and did not have enough role to bring out the characters they were meant to portray. And the cliché dialogues brought this one down.
It's a nice one if you're not expecting too much historical accuracy or anything else but I personally have seen older versions of the same movie which are far better.
Easy A (2010)
Refreshing and Intelligent
When I sat down to watch this movie I wasn't expecting anything more than a boring, half-spun, tale of a misunderstood teenager where everything in her life goes wrong and she does stupid things to set them right. Throw in a love affair or two in there too.
But NO. Easy A was surprisingly thought provoking and hilarious. It was simply and clean cut. The execution was flawless for such a simple plot. The characters were well written and the actors who played them were well cast.
After having seen a string of unoriginal, bland chick flicks the genre has basically been reduced to a category of nonsensical, waste-time movies in my opinion. It's wonderful to see some intelligent film makers out there who can combine the woes of growing up, make a lesson of it and portray it in a comic light.
There is nothing about this movie that I disliked... except that it was too short. I hope they make a sequel. I recommend you go watch it.
